http://dbpedia.org/ontology/abstract Ninde-Mead-Farnsworth House, also known asNinde-Mead-Farnsworth House, also known as Iriscrest and the Philo T. Farnsworth House, is a historic home located at Fort Wayne, Indiana. It was built about 1910, and is a 1+1⁄2-story, side gabled, Colonial Revival style frame dwelling. It features a pedimented entrance portico. It has American Craftsman style design elements including shed roofed dormers and overhanging eaves. Television pioneer Philo Farnsworth (1906–1971) lived here from 1948 to 1967.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2013.ional Register of Historic Places in 2013.
